/drivers/gpu/drm/radeon/ |
H A D | mkregtable.c | 279 struct list_head *first = list->next; local 282 first->prev = prev; 283 prev->next = first; 292 * @head: the place to add it in the first list. 304 * @head: the place to add it in the first list. 316 * @head: the place to add it in the first list. 332 * @head: the place to add it in the first list. 356 * list_first_entry - get the first element from a list 669 /* first line will contain the last register
|
/drivers/ide/ |
H A D | siimage.c | 644 * and then do the MMIO setup if we can. This is the first 750 static int first = 1; local 752 if (first) { 755 first = 0;
|
H A D | Kconfig | 59 a few first-generation SATA controllers. 297 bool "Boot off-board chipsets first support (DEPRECATED)" 474 off-board chipsets first support" (CONFIG_BLK_DEV_OFFBOARD) unless 668 bool "Probe on-board ATA/100 (Kauai) first"
|
/drivers/md/ |
H A D | multipath.c | 41 * now we use the first available disk. 175 * first available device 195 * first check if this is a queued request for a device 253 int first = 0; local 257 first = last = rdev->raid_disk; 261 for (path = first; path <= last; path++)
|
H A D | raid10.c | 492 * first chunk, followed by near_copies copies of the next chunk and 517 /* now calculate first sector/dev */ 697 * the resync window. We take the first readable disk when 1015 * If the first succeeds but the second blocks due to the resync 1144 /* first select target devices under rcu_lock and 1397 int first = 0; local 1403 if (conf->mirrors[first].rdev && 1404 first != ignore) 1406 first = (first 1537 int first = 0; local 1789 int i, first; local [all...] |
/drivers/tty/serial/ |
H A D | pnx8xxx_uart.c | 644 static int first = 1; local 647 if (!first) 649 first = 0; 717 * if so, search for the first available port that does have
|
H A D | dz.c | 771 static int first = 1; local 775 if (!first) 777 first = 0; 809 * line first, in which case we have to disable its transmitter and
|
/drivers/net/hamradio/ |
H A D | dmascc.c | 271 static struct scc_info *first; variable in typeref:struct:scc_info 285 while (first) { 286 info = first; 303 first = info->next; 602 info->next = first; 603 first = info; 1001 /* Write first byte(s) */
|
/drivers/scsi/aic94xx/ |
H A D | aic94xx_hwi.c | 206 * asd_init_scbs - manually allocate the first SCB. 209 * This allocates the very first SCB which would be sent to the 1106 struct asd_ascb *first = NULL; local 1113 else if (!first) 1114 first = ascb; 1116 struct asd_ascb *last = list_entry(first->list.prev, 1119 list_add_tail(&ascb->list, &first->list); 1125 return first; 1136 * DMA to the host adapter this list of SCBs. But the head (first 1189 * @ascb: pointer to the first aSC [all...] |
/drivers/auxdisplay/ |
H A D | Kconfig | 43 The first standard parallel port address is 0x378.
|
/drivers/pcmcia/ |
H A D | pxa2xx_sharpsl.c | 204 .first = 0,
|
H A D | sa1111_generic.c | 147 s->soc.nr = ops->first + i;
|
/drivers/sn/ |
H A D | ioc3.c | 339 unsigned long first, addr; local 346 addr = first = nic_find(idd, &save, 0); 347 if(!first) 365 if(addr == first)
|
/drivers/staging/omapdrm/ |
H A D | tcm-sita.c | 609 * NOTE: For horizontal bias we always give the first found, because our 610 * scan is horizontal-raster-based and the first candidate will always 613 bool first = criteria & CR_BIAS_HORIZONTAL; local 618 if (!first) { 628 BUG_ON(first); 648 return first;
|
/drivers/scsi/ |
H A D | scsi_scan.c | 564 /* Perform up to 3 passes. The first pass uses a conservative 641 /* When the first pass succeeds we gain information about 667 * the same amount as we successfully got in the first pass. */ 690 * On the whole, the best approach seems to be to assume the first 959 * @buf: Output buffer with at least end-first+1 bytes of space 961 * @first: Offset of string into inq 965 unsigned first, unsigned end) 969 for (idx = 0; idx + first < end && idx + first < inq[4] + 5; idx++) { 970 if (inq[idx+first] > ' ') { 964 scsi_inq_str(unsigned char *buf, unsigned char *inq, unsigned first, unsigned end) argument [all...] |
/drivers/dma/ |
H A D | pl330.c | 334 * first request and a request with new settings. 394 /* Pointer to first xfer in the request. */ 1063 * We do it by writing DMAEND as the first instruction 1065 * its first instruction to execute. 2785 struct dma_pl330_desc *first, *desc = NULL; local 2797 first = NULL; 2808 if (!first) 2813 while (!list_empty(&first->node)) { 2814 desc = list_entry(first->node.next, 2819 list_move_tail(&first [all...] |
/drivers/atm/ |
H A D | zatm.c | 182 struct rx_buffer_head *first; local 210 first = NULL; 225 if (!first) first = head; 241 if (first) { 244 zout(virt_to_bus(first),CER);
|
/drivers/isdn/i4l/ |
H A D | isdn_ppp.c | 315 is->first = is->rq + NUM_RCV_BUFFS - 1; /* receive queue */ 372 is->first = is->rq + NUM_RCV_BUFFS - 1; /* receive queue */ 687 bf = is->first; 733 bf = is->first; 737 printk(KERN_WARNING "ippp: Queue is full; discarding first buffer\n"); 740 is->first = bf; 773 b = is->first->next; 782 is->first = b; 888 ippp_table[i]->first = ippp_table[i]->rq + NUM_RCV_BUFFS - 1; 1561 } else { /* first lin [all...] |
/drivers/scsi/fcoe/ |
H A D | fcoe_ctlr.c | 908 int first = 0; local 915 first = list_empty(&fip->fcfs); 972 * the first advertisement we've received, do a multicast 976 if (first && time_after(jiffies, fip->sol_time + sol_tov)) 989 * If this is the first validated FCF, note the time and 1063 * with first MAC(granted_mac) being the FPMA, and the 1453 struct fcoe_fcf *first; local 1455 first = list_first_entry(&fip->fcfs, struct fcoe_fcf, list); 1464 if (fcf->fabric_name != first->fabric_name || 1465 fcf->vfid != first [all...] |
/drivers/dma/ioat/ |
H A D | dma.c | 235 struct ioat_desc_sw *first; local 245 first = to_ioat_desc(desc->tx_list.next); 249 chain_tail->hw->next = first->txd.phys; 252 dump_desc_dbg(ioat, first); 376 /* Before freeing channel resources first check 825 /* Start copy, using first DMA channel */
|
/drivers/net/wireless/ath/carl9170/ |
H A D | tx.c | 971 * NOTE: For the first rate, the ERP & AMPDU flags are directly 1086 struct sk_buff *skb, *first; local 1122 first = skb_peek(&tid_info->queue); 1123 tmpssn = carl9170_get_seq(first); 1142 if (!carl9170_tx_rate_check(ar, skb, first))
|
/drivers/scsi/aacraid/ |
H A D | linit.c | 87 * become important. Check for on-board Raid first, add-in cards second. 355 * Read the first 1024 bytes from the disk device, if the boot 364 struct partition *first = (struct partition * )buf; local 365 struct partition *entry = first; 391 end_head = first->end_head; 392 end_sec = first->end_sector & 0x3f;
|
/drivers/gpio/ |
H A D | gpio-msm-v1.c | 277 #define MSM_GPIO_BANK(soc, bank, first, last) \ 290 .base = (first), \ 291 .ngpio = (last) - (first) + 1, \
|
/drivers/media/video/omap3isp/ |
H A D | ispqueue.c | 298 * pages is first computed based on the buffer size, and pages are then 312 * first place. 320 unsigned int first; local 325 first = (data & PAGE_MASK) >> PAGE_SHIFT; 329 buf->npages = last - first + 1; 414 * The buffer vm_flags field is set to the first VMA flags. 839 * The v4l2_buffer structure passed from userspace is first sanity tested. If 911 * The v4l2_buffer structure passed from userspace is first sanity tested. If
|
/drivers/spi/ |
H A D | spi-bfin-sport.c | 529 "the first transfer len is %d\n", 575 struct bfin_sport_spi_slave_data *chip, *first = NULL; local 578 /* Only alloc (or use chip_info) on first setup */ 583 chip = first = kzalloc(sizeof(*chip), GFP_KERNEL); 647 kfree(first);
|